Starbucks, the Seattle-based coffee giant, will launch its 2025 fall menu on August 26, maintaining its tradition of releasing autumn-themed treats late in the summer. The lineup features both beloved returning items and at least one new addition, combining traditional offerings with fresh, innovative flavors.

According to The Chosun Daily, Starbucks Korea phased out plastic straws in 2018, likely because of complaints about the environmental impact of single-use plastics. However, in late June, the coffee chain began offering the upgraded plastic straws alongside paper versions at around 200 stores.
